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ake Ingredients
For the Crust
• 1 ½ cups graham cracker crumbs – This forms the buttery base; substitute with gluten-free graham crackers or almond flour for a gluten-free version.
• ⅓ cup granulated sugar – Adds sweetness to the crust; adjust to taste or use a sugar substitute if desired.
• 6 tbsp unsalted butter, melted – Binds the crumbs together; you can use coconut oil for a dairy-free option.
For the Filling
• 1 (8 oz) block cream cheese, room temperature – Provides richness and structure; ensure it’s softened for smoother mixing.
• 1 cup granulated sugar – The main sweetener for the filling; use less for a less sweet cheesecake or a sugar substitute for lower calories.
• 1 cup sour cream – Adds creaminess and tang; plain yogurt can be a lighter substitute.
• 1 tsp vanilla extract – Enhances flavor; opt for pure extract for the best results.
• 4 large eggs – Provides stability; remember these should be at room temperature for optimal blending.
• 2 tbsp all-purpose flour – Helps set the filling; can be replaced with a gluten-free flour blend if needed.
• ¼ cup raspberry puree – Infuses the filling with vibrant raspberry flavor; make from fresh or frozen raspberries.
For the Swirl
• ½ cup raspberry puree – Used for a beautiful topping; straining seeds can enhance smoothness if you prefer.
• 2 tbsp sugar (for swirl) – Sweetens the raspberry mixture; adjust this based on the natural sweetness of your raspberries.
For Garnish
• Whipped cream, Fresh raspberries, Powdered sugar – Optional but highly recommended to elevate visual appeal and taste.
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 325°F (163°C). This temperature is ideal for baking the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ake, ensuring a creamy texture without overcooking. While the oven warms up, gather your ingredients and equipment—a 9×13 inch pan for the crust and mixing bowls for combining your ingredients.
Step 2: Prepare the Crust
In a bowl, combine the graham cracker crumbs, granulated sugar, and melted butter. Mix these ingredients until well combined, resembling wet sand. Press the mixture firmly into the bottom of your prepared pan, creating an even layer. Once done, place it in the refrigerator to chill for about 10 minutes, allowing it to firm up before adding the cheesecake filling.
Step 3: Make the Filling
In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ese and one cup of sugar together until smooth and creamy, about 2-3 minutes. Ensure there are no lumps, which is key for your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ake’s texture. Add in the sour cream and vanilla extract, mixing until completely blended and fluffy, bringing richness to your filling.
Step 4: Incorporate the Eggs
Next, add the eggs one at a time, mixing thoroughly after each addition. This gradual process helps integrate the eggs smoothly into the cheesecake filling without overmixing, which could lead to cracks during baking. Gently fold in the all-purpose flour and ¼ cup of raspberry puree, ensuring an even distribution of flavors and color.
Step 5: Assemble the Cheesecake
Pour the cheesecake mixture over the prepared graham cracker crust, spreading it evenly with a spatula. This forms the delightful base for your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ake. The filling should be smooth and thick, giving it a rich appearance. Prepare for the final swirling step by setting aside half a cup of raspberry puree for the topping.
Step 6: Create the Raspberry Swirl
Combine the reserved raspberry puree with the two tablespoons of sugar in a small bowl and stir until blended. Drop spoonfuls of this mixture onto the surface of the cheesecake, then use a toothpick to gently swirl the raspberry into the cheesecake. This artistic touch not only enhances flavor but also adds a visually appealing design.
Step 7: Bake the Cheesecake
Place the assembled cheesecake pan in the preheated oven and bake for 35-40 minutes. The edges should be set, while the middle might still have a slight jiggle, indicating the luscious texture you’re aiming for. Keep an eye on it to prevent overbaking, as this will affect the final creaminess of your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ake.
Step 8: Cool and Chill
Once done baking, remove the cheesecake from the oven and allow it to cool to room temperature for approximately 1 hour. After cooling, cover the pan and refrigerate for at least 3 hours, although overnight is best for enhancing the flavors and setting the cheesecake perfectly.

Expert Tips for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ake
-
Use Room Temperature Ingredients: Start with cream cheese and eggs at room temperature to ensure a smooth filling without lumps.
-
Gentle Mixing: Avoid overmixing after adding the eggs; this prevents cracks in the cheesecake during baking, keeping it beautiful and intact.
-
Chill for Best Flavor: Allowing the cheesecake to chill overnight develops richer flavors and a firmer texture, making each bite unforgettable.
-
Perfect Raspberry Puree: Blend fresh or frozen raspberries with a bit of water for a smooth puree. Strain seeds for an even silkier texture in your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ake.
-
Watch Baking Time: Keep an eye on the cheesecake as it bakes. If the edges are set but the center has a gentle jiggle, it’s perfect to come out of the oven!
Storage Tips for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ake
-
Fridge: Store leftover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ake in an airtight container for up to 5 days, ensuring it retains its creamy texture and flavor.
-
Freezer: For longer storage, wrap individual slices in plastic wrap and then foil, keeping them in the freezer for up to 2 months; thaw overnight in the refrigerator before serving.
-
Reheating: If desired, serve the cheesecake chilled without reheating as it maintains its delightful texture and refreshingly rich taste.

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ake Recipe FAQs
How do I select the right raspberries?
Absolutely! When choosing raspberries, look for ones that are plump, firm, and vibrant in color. Avoid any that have dark spots all over, as this indicates overripeness. Fresh raspberries will yield the best flavor for your puree, but if you opt for frozen ones, ensure they are unsweetened for the purest taste.
What’s the best way to store leftover cheesecake?
Very! Store any leftover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. This helps maintain its creamy texture and rich flavor. I often use a glass container with a tight lid, which keeps it fresh and prevents it from absorbing any other odors.
Can I freeze the cheesecake? How?
Absolutely! To freeze your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ake, wrap individual slices in plastic wrap, ensuring they are tightly sealed to prevent freezer burn. Then, place them in a zip-top freezer bag or an airtight container. The cheesecake can be frozen for up to 2 months; simply thaw the slices in the refrigerator overnight before serving for the best texture.
What should I do if my cheesecake cracks during baking?
Oh no! If you notice cracks forming in your cheesecake, don’t worry—it’s a common issue. To prevent this, ensure you mix the eggs gently into the batter and avoid overmixing once they’re added. If cracks do occur, a simple trick is to cover them with whipped cream or fresh raspberries when you serve—an elegant solution that adds beauty!
Is this recipe safe for people with gluten allergies?
Yes, indeed! This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ake can easily be adapted for those with gluten sensitivities. Simply substitute the graham cracker crumbs with gluten-free graham crackers or almond flour to create a delicious gluten-free crust. Always check the labels to ensure other ingredients, like sugar and vanilla extract, are gluten-free.
Can pets eat raspberry cheesecake?
No, it’s best to avoid giving cheesecake to pets. While raspberries are safe for dogs in moderation, the high sugar and dairy content in cheesecake can upset their stomachs. Stick to dog-friendly treats to keep your furry friends happy!
